Finance History | 707 Second Avenue South — One Ameriprise Share for Five American Express Shares

People treat Ameriprise as a Minneapolis planning firm and a later bank holding company.
The listed company was cut out of American Express on a Friday and printed on a Monday.
The Minneapolis book began as Investors Diversified Services. American Express bought that franchise in 1984. On 1 January 1995 the unit took the name American Express Financial Corporation and sold advice as American Express Financial Advisors.
On 30 September 2005 American Express distributed the stock. Shareholders received one share of Ameriprise Financial for every five shares of American Express. About 246 million Ameriprise shares went out.
Trading opened on the New York Stock Exchange on 3 October 2005 under the ticker AMP. MarketWatch recorded a first trade of 35.30 dollars and a close of 34.70 dollars in 2005 currency.
Standard and Poor's put the new company into the S and P 500 the same day, replacing Providian Financial.
The mechanism is a payments company shedding an advice-and-insurance book so each balance sheet can be priced alone. The card network kept the brand on plastic. The planners kept the Minneapolis tower.
This 29-story building at 707 Second Avenue South opened in 2000 as Ameriprise Financial Center. The firm later said it would leave the tower when the lease expired in 2025 and fold staff into 901 Third Avenue South.
The pin is the public sidewalk on Second Avenue. The interior floors are a working office.
